What Kind of Kevlar is Used in Bulletproof Vest

Sunday 6 December 2009 @ 11:18 am

Bulletproof vest equipment is primarily intended to protect the chest, abdomen and back cons firing of Fire arms absorbing the impact. The vests are made of tightly woven fibers, mainly Kevlar. This type of jacket can protect the wearer against bullets of Handguns and the shrapnel some explosive devices such as grenades. You can drag plates of metal or ceramic in pockets provided there for in the front and back of vests to allow it to stop 5.56mm bullets, but by raising a few pounds weight vest. Forces police usually wear the vest alone, while the ceramic plates or metal are used by the national armed forces or special police intervention, such as SWAT U.S. or GIGN French.

Metal plates (steel or titanium), ceramic or Polyethylene provide additional protection in vital organs. They provide effective protection against all ammunition for handguns (with exceptions) and most rifles. These “body armor tactics” have become a standard in the military, because the body armor does not classic enough resistance against the projectiles of assault rifles weapons that the military might often face. The NATO CRISAT (Collaborative Research into Small Arms Technology-North Atlantic Treaty Organization) recommends Titanium plates.

Unlike metal armor of the World Wars II, the modern bulletproof vest does not deflect bullets, but rather halt the projectiles by absorbing kinetic energy they emit, and redistributing the largest possible portion of the body. It’s just the same principle of snowshoes in the snow, which distribute the weight of the person over a larger area so it does not penetrate the layer of snow. The kinetic energy of the bullet that is redistributed does not penetrate the body. Moreover, this phenomenon distorts a bit the bullet, which diminishes its power of penetration. Note that despite the fact of bulletproof vest prevented the bullets from penetrating to the body still absorbs the energy of the ball, which can cause internal injuries. Even though most of the time we get out with a blue. The impact can cause serious injuries such as internal bleeding, tearing at the fabric or even broken ribs.

Chemical Peel at Home for Anti-aging Skin Disease

Sunday 6 December 2009 @ 9:08 am

The chemical peel at home for the fight against the disease of aging is becoming popular, especially among those who can not afford a clinically assisted peeling. The chemical peel is a cosmetic skin procedure that uses chemicals to rejuvenate the skin. Kits at home chemical peel may be prepared at home using natural peels affordable. The technique of chemical peel is used in the treatment of rosacea, blemishes, discoloration, wrinkles, fine lines and acne. A chemical peel removes the top layers of skin cells dull, dry and dead.

The chemical peel at home has the potential to absorb more moisture from the skin. Keratin developed on the surface which interferes with moisturizers trade can clog pores and cause skin irritation. The chemical peel at home will be absorbed by the skin because they are weaker in its form or its concentration.

These kits contain the same ingredients that peel administered by the physician with the exception of the weakening of the force in the form or concentration. This allows chemical peels house to be used safely.

Among the ingredients in the kit are found salicylic acid, TPP, resorcinol, sulfur and phenol.

The process for applying a chemical peel is simple. After applying the skin exfoliates and the process is completed in 10-12 minutes. Various brands are available on the market, read the label and be careful with side effects. It is also recommended to understand the sensitivity of the skin before undergoing treatment. The home chemical peel removes dead cells from the skin and helps anti-aging and to prevent any sort of skin disease.
